    "Manage hostnames" list only contain "English (United States)"

    I'm trying to figure out how to get LongDate to show in a different language than english. I have set the globalization setting in web.config like so:

    <globalization requestEncoding="UTF-8" responseEncoding="UTF-8" culture="nb-no" uiCulture="nb-no" />

    But when right-clicking the Content-node -> "Manage hostnames", I am only able to see "English (United States)" in the language list.

    Any suggestions?

    You need to add the language under Settings/Languages in Umbraco Admin to get be able to select the language.
